Is 148 247 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 148 247 is about 385.029.

Thus, the square root of 148 247 is not an integer, and therefore 148 247 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 148 247?

The square of a number (here 148 247) is the result of the product of this number (148 247) by itself (i.e., 148 247 × 148 247); the square of 148 247 is sometimes called "raising 148 247 to the power 2", or "148 247 squared".

The square of 148 247 is 21 977 173 009 because 148 247 × 148 247 = 148 2472 = 21 977 173 009.

As a consequence, 148 247 is the square root of 21 977 173 009.
